<feed xmlns='http://www.w3.org/2005/Atom'>
<title>staging/kaloz, branch master</title>
<subtitle>Staging tree of Imre Kaloz</subtitle>
<id>https://git.openwrt.org/openwrt/staging/kaloz/atom?h=master</id>
<link rel='self' href='https://git.openwrt.org/openwrt/staging/kaloz/atom?h=master'/>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/'/>
<updated>2018-02-15T18:57:05Z</updated>
<entry>
<title>Newer Linksys boards might come with a Winbond W29N02GV which can be</title>
<updated>2018-02-15T18:57:05Z</updated>
<author>
<name>Imre Kaloz</name>
</author>
<published>2018-02-15T18:57:05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=7ae59a2f288ba1cef23b20e1d36e199e8c646245'/>
<id>urn:sha1:7ae59a2f288ba1cef23b20e1d36e199e8c646245</id>
<content type='text'>
configured in different ways. Make sure we configure it the same way
as the older chips so everything keeps working.

Signed-off-by: Imre Kaloz &lt;kaloz@openwrt.org&gt;
</content>
</entry>
<entry>
<title>ramips: preliminary support for 4.14</title>
<updated>2018-02-15T09:46:39Z</updated>
<author>
<name>Roman Yeryomin</name>
</author>
<published>2018-01-16T22:07:58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=f4e5880d0f3496a3151fe24d87ca2d08d3403a83'/>
<id>urn:sha1:f4e5880d0f3496a3151fe24d87ca2d08d3403a83</id>
<content type='text'>
- removed upstreamed patches
- 0901-spansion_nand_id_fix.patch is disabled, not clear if it's needed

Signed-off-by: Roman Yeryomin &lt;roman@advem.lv&gt;
Signed-off-by: John Crispin &lt;john@phrozen.org&gt;
</content>
</entry>
<entry>
<title>iwinfo: update to latest git HEAD</title>
<updated>2018-02-15T03:57:38Z</updated>
<author>
<name>Daniel Golle</name>
</author>
<published>2018-02-15T03:56:26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=a3b9cbafc33a94606368226020e7b69ff85f1115'/>
<id>urn:sha1:a3b9cbafc33a94606368226020e7b69ff85f1115</id>
<content type='text'>
223e09b add support for expected throughput

Signed-off-by: Daniel Golle &lt;daniel@makrotopia.org&gt;
</content>
</entry>
<entry>
<title>ramips: fix reporting effective VLAN ID on MT7621 switches</title>
<updated>2018-02-14T15:43:30Z</updated>
<author>
<name>Jo-Philipp Wich</name>
</author>
<published>2018-02-13T14:58:48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=dc7a1e855513d415ac0837b34400b98052c2090c'/>
<id>urn:sha1:dc7a1e855513d415ac0837b34400b98052c2090c</id>
<content type='text'>
On MT7621, the REG_ESW_VLAN_VTIM reads are undefined, causing swconfig
to always report `vid: 0` in swconfig show output.

Since a 4K VLAN table is used on this platform, the VLAN ID always
correponds to the actual VLAN table index so provide a specific MT7621
implementation of the get_vid callback which returns the table index
as VLAN ID.

Signed-off-by: Jo-Philipp Wich &lt;jo@mein.io&gt;
</content>
</entry>
<entry>
<title>ramips: properly map pvid for vlans with remapped vid on mt7530/762x switches</title>
<updated>2018-02-14T15:43:30Z</updated>
<author>
<name>Jo-Philipp Wich</name>
</author>
<published>2018-02-13T14:37:49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=341b1427fc247fd4c53f390f2f17258dcf052a50'/>
<id>urn:sha1:341b1427fc247fd4c53f390f2f17258dcf052a50</id>
<content type='text'>
Currently, untagged port primary vlan IDs are set to the VLAN table index,
and not the actual VLAN ID, breaking configurations with IDs deviating from
the VLAN index.

Fix the issue by resolving the per-port pvid property to the target VLAN ID
value before committing to the hardware.

Fixes FS#991, FS#1147, FS#1341

Signed-off-by: Jo-Philipp Wich &lt;jo@mein.io&gt;
</content>
</entry>
<entry>
<title>ramips: don't clobber vlans with remapped vid on mt7530/762x switches</title>
<updated>2018-02-14T15:43:29Z</updated>
<author>
<name>Jo-Philipp Wich</name>
</author>
<published>2018-02-11T19:24:37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=bb4002c79dd8ea7bec9643707277944da90d002c'/>
<id>urn:sha1:bb4002c79dd8ea7bec9643707277944da90d002c</id>
<content type='text'>
Avoid overwriting vlan entries with remapped vid in later iterations of
the vlan enumeration loop of mt7530_apply_config().

Fix the problem by refactoring the code to first reset the entire table,
then reprogram only vlans with members to prevent overwriting configured
vlans with unconfigured ones.

Fixes FS#1147, FS#1341

Signed-off-by: Jo-Philipp Wich &lt;jo@mein.io&gt;
</content>
</entry>
<entry>
<title>at91: fix image building with CONFIG_TARGET_MULTI_PROFILE</title>
<updated>2018-02-14T14:47:16Z</updated>
<author>
<name>Jo-Philipp Wich</name>
</author>
<published>2018-02-13T15:12:08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=b9aca834e812efc9d0bb2701eab8c78f2efb0367'/>
<id>urn:sha1:b9aca834e812efc9d0bb2701eab8c78f2efb0367</id>
<content type='text'>
The current image build code has a number of race conditions and interface
contract violations in the custom image build steps:

 - Build/install-zImage, solely used by at91, relies on $(PROFILE_SANITIZED)
   which is not available when building with CONFIG_TARGET_MULTI_PROFILE

 - Build/at91-sdcard, which may run concurrently, creates scratch files at
   fixed locations and manipulates target files directly which can lead
   to file corruption and other unexpected failures

Rename the install-zImage macro to at91-install-zImage and move it to the
at91 image Makefile since this target is the sole user. Also utilize "$@"
as output file name and switch the usage of $(PROFILE_SANITIZED) to
$(DEVICE_NAME) in order to fix naming under multi profile builds.

Fix the at91-sdcard macro to construct scratch file paths relative to "$@",
which is guaranteed to be unique and store the final artifact output in "$@"
as well, instead of inside $(BIN_DIR). The generic image build code takes
care of moving a build steps "$@" output to the final destination in a
concurrency-safe manner.

Finally remove the broken install-zImage from the generic image-commands
Makefile.

Fixes: d7a679a036 ("at91: Install zImage.")
Signed-off-by: Jo-Philipp Wich &lt;jo@mein.io&gt;
</content>
</entry>
<entry>
<title>mediatek: bump to v4.14</title>
<updated>2018-02-14T10:27:50Z</updated>
<author>
<name>John Crispin</name>
</author>
<published>2018-01-08T14:06:24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=7762c07c88980cff85ec20c12f18cd172260e9d9'/>
<id>urn:sha1:7762c07c88980cff85ec20c12f18cd172260e9d9</id>
<content type='text'>
This drops support for all the !emmc EVB and adds banannaPi-R2
Also drop mtkhnat until the nftables offoad driver is ready

Signed-off-by: John Crispin &lt;john@phrozen.org&gt;
</content>
</entry>
<entry>
<title>ipq806x: add support for GL.iNet GL-B1300</title>
<updated>2018-02-14T08:40:32Z</updated>
<author>
<name>Dongming Han</name>
</author>
<published>2017-12-07T12:48:19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=04d3308b6248ef21a6f0bc3378b342906c2d2865'/>
<id>urn:sha1:04d3308b6248ef21a6f0bc3378b342906c2d2865</id>
<content type='text'>
This patch adds support for GL.iNet GL-B1300

Specification:
- SOC:        IPQ4028 / QCA Dakota
- RAM:        256 MiB
- FLASH:      32 MiB
- ETH:        Qualcomm Atheros QCA8075 Gigabit Switch (2 x LAN, 1 x WAN)
- USB:        1 x 3.0 (via Synopsys DesignWare DWC3 controller in the SoC)
- WLAN1:      Qualcomm Atheros QCA4028 2.4GHz 802.11bgn 2:2x2
- WLAN2:      Qualcomm Atheros QCA4028 5GHz 802.11a/n/ac 2:2x2
- INPUT:      one reset and one WPS button
- LEDS:       3 leds: Power, WIFI(only for 2.4G currently), and one reserved
- UART:       1 x UART on PCB (3.3V, TX, RX, GND) - 115200 8N1

Installation:
Method 1:
- use serial port to stop uboot
- uboot command: run lf
Method 2:
- push down reset button and power on
- wait until three leds constantly on then release
- upgrade by uboot web at http://192.168.1.1
Note:
- the sysupgrade image need to be renamed to lede-gl-b1300.bin in both method.
- the sysupgrade image can be automatically downloaded if tftp server at
  192.168.1.2 have that file.
- the wifi led will be flashing when writing image.

Signed-off-by: Dongming Han &lt;handongming@gl-inet.com&gt;
</content>
</entry>
<entry>
<title>ubox: update to latest git HEAD</title>
<updated>2018-02-14T08:30:07Z</updated>
<author>
<name>John Crispin</name>
</author>
<published>2018-02-14T08:28:52Z</published>
<link rel='alternate' type='text/html' href='https://git.openwrt.org/openwrt/staging/kaloz/commit/?id=88a41074e8e7012c2cb73b85263425c4c474beb1'/>
<id>urn:sha1:88a41074e8e7012c2cb73b85263425c4c474beb1</id>
<content type='text'>
128bc35 logread: fix reconnect logd logic
66347ec logread: move the code setting up the request blob out of the main loop
975a258 logread: move output connection setup code out of main loop
b81bea7 logread: cleanup pid file handling
d73e7d2 ubox: Replace strerror(errno) with %m format.

Signed-off-by: John Crispin &lt;john@phrozen.org&gt;
</content>
</entry>
</feed>
